What is P0507?

Idle speed is higher than the ECM expects. May be caused by a vacuum leak, stuck IAC valve, or throttle body issue.

Recommended Fixes
Inspect and replace cracked vacuum lines and PCV hoses
Clean throttle body and perform IAVL procedure
Replace intake manifold gasket if leaking
Replace IACV if stuck open (older models)

Notes for Nissan Pathfinder

Check the large intake boot between the MAF and throttle body; cracks here are a very common high-idle cause on Nissan.
